Study On Creep Properties Of Fly Ash Concrete Under Sulfate Attack

Creep as one of the influencing factors of concrete durability,is the deformation of concrete structure with time under load.This characteristic is affected by concrete performance,load,environmental conditions and other factors.Concrete is also widely used in the construction of water conservancy projects.Compared with ordinary engineering buildings,the environmental factors faced by hydraulic engineering buildings are more complex.Water conservancy buildings in coastal areas and inland areas with high content of erosive substances(such as salt lakes)suffer from erosion for a long time,which seriously affects the durability of concrete.In sulfate environment,the creep of fly ash concrete corroded by sulfate involves multiple factors of physics chemistry mechanics,and the mechanism is very complex.Therefore,the research on the performance of fly ash concrete in corrosive environment can play an effective role in practical engineering,and it is also of great significance to the creep performance of concrete.In this paper,the creep law of fly ash concrete under sulfate attack is studied theoretically and experimentally.The main research contents are as follows:(1)Based on the analysis results,it is found that the concrete creep increases with the increase of sulfate solution concentration,and fly ash can inhibit the concrete creep,and the creep decreases with the increase of fly ash content;(2)According to Fick's second diffusion law,based on the diffusion rate and depth of sulfate ion in fly ash concrete,the sulfate ion diffusion model and the damage deterioration model of fly ash concrete are established,and their accuracy is verified by test data;(3)On the basis of the above research,the B4 model based on consolidation theory is modified,and combined with the damage theory of concrete,the creep calculation model of fly ash concrete under sulfate attack is established.Through the comparison of test data in this paper,its feasibility is verified;(4)Through regression calculation,the creep design formula of fly ash concrete under sulfate attack is established,and compared with the test data,the feasibility of the formula is verified.
